- W2023349053 abstract "Combining lumpectomy and axillary dissection with breast irradiation (RT) has been established as a safe and effective alternative to mastectomy. More recently, this therapeutic approach has been refined in a number of ways. The importance of margin status has become better appreciated, and adequate margins are now achieved in the vast majority of cases. Surgical management of the axilla has also undergone revolutionary changes with the advent of sentinel lymph node surgery. The RT component of breast-conserving therapy has also improved. The use of three-dimensional treatment planning and multileaf three-dimensional dose compensation has improved the conformity and dose uniformity of radiation delivery. Finally, systemic treatments are now the standard rather than the exception for women with early-stage breast cancer, and it has been demonstrated that the use of systemic therapy significantly decreases the rate of breast recurrence, in addition to providing benefits against metastatic disease. With these improvements, both the rates of breast recurrences after breast conservation and the morbidity of locoregional treatment have decreased. For example, for favorable breast cancer, two recent series have indicated that the 8-year probability of breast recurrence for patients treated with adequate surgery, whole breast RT, and systemic treatment was only 3% ( 1 Fisher B. Bryant J. Dignam J.J. et al. Tamoxifen, radiation therapy or both for prevention of ipsilateral breast tumor recurrence after lumpectomy in women with invasive breast cancers of one centimeter or less. J Clin Oncol. 2002; 20: 4141-4149 Crossref PubMed Scopus (552) Google Scholar , 2 Buchholz T.A. Tucker S.L. Erwin J. et al. Impact of systemic treatment on local control for patients with lymph node-negative breast cancer treated with breast-conserving therapy. J Clin Oncol. 2001; 19: 2240-2246 PubMed Google Scholar ), and the toxicity associated with locoregional therapy was also quite low." @default.
